1. 什么是Shadowsocks?
Shadowsocks是一种开源代理工具,常用于科学上网。它能够通过加密的方式,让用户绕过网络限制,安全地访问被屏蔽的网站。为了使用Shadowsocks,用户需要选择合适的主机进行部署。
2. Shadowsocks主机的类型
在选择Shadowsocks主机时,用户需要了解以下几种主机类型:
- VPS(虚拟私人服务器):提供更高的灵活性和控制权,用户可以自行配置Shadowsocks。
- 云主机:通常有较高的可用性和扩展性,适合需要快速部署的用户。
- 共享主机:相对便宜,但通常对性能和安全性有一定影响。
3. 选择Shadowsocks主机的因素
选择合适的Shadowsocks主机时,用户应考虑以下因素:
- 速度:确保主机的带宽和延迟能够满足日常使用的需求。
- 稳定性:选择有良好用户评价的主机提供商,以保证服务的持续可用性。
- 安全性:确保提供商具有良好的数据保护政策,防止用户数据泄露。
- 支持多种协议:确保主机支持Shadowsocks以及其他必要的网络协议。
- 价格:根据预算选择性价比高的主机,不必盲目追求便宜。
4. 推荐的Shadowsocks主机
根据用户反馈和市场评价,以下是一些推荐的Shadowsocks主机:
- Vultr:以其优秀的性能和全球节点而受到用户喜爱。
- DigitalOcean:提供简单易用的控制面板,适合初学者。
- Linode:稳定性强,适合需要高性能的用户。
- AWS(亚马逊云服务):提供强大的基础设施,适合大流量用户。
5. Shadowsocks主机的安装和配置
安装Shadowsocks主机通常需要以下步骤:
-
选择合适的VPS或云主机提供商。
-
购买并配置服务器:按照提供商的指示,完成购买和配置过程。
-
安装Shadowsocks:使用命令行工具,下载并安装Shadowsocks服务端。
- 示例命令: bash git clone https://github.com/shadowsocks/shadowsocks.git cd shadowsocks pip install -r requirements.txt
-
配置Shadowsocks:编辑配置文件,设置端口、密码等信息。
-
启动Shadowsocks服务:通过命令行启动Shadowsocks,确保服务正常运行。
- 示例命令: bash python server.py -c config.json
6. 使用Shadowsocks客户端
用户可以通过以下步骤来使用Shadowsocks客户端连接到主机:
- 下载客户端:根据操作系统选择合适的Shadowsocks客户端。
- 配置客户端:输入服务器地址、端口和密码等信息。
- 连接测试:确保连接成功后,可以开始安全地浏览网络。
7. Shadowsocks主机常见问题解答(FAQ)
Shadowsocks是什么?
Shadowsocks是一种代理工具,允许用户绕过网络限制,安全地访问互联网。它通过加密数据来保护用户隐私。
我如何选择合适的Shadowsocks主机?
选择时应考虑速度、稳定性、安全性和价格等因素。建议根据需求选择合适的主机类型,如VPS或云主机。
如何安装Shadowsocks主机?
安装通常包括选择提供商、购买服务器、安装Shadowsocks和配置服务。具体步骤可参考上述指南。
使用Shadowsocks需要付费吗?
是的,大部分Shadowsocks主机需要付费,费用根据服务类型和提供商而异。
Shadowsocks和VPN有什么区别?
Shadowsocks是一种轻量级的代理工具,而VPN提供的是全局网络覆盖,Shadowsocks更灵活,适合绕过特定网站的限制。
正文完